You may not know about a lady named Tammy Jo Kirk, from Dalton, GA. She was a local champion motocross rider who was successful in the NASCAR All Pro late model series from '91 through about '95. She got a break in either '96 or '97 with a lingerie company who sponsored her in a NASCAR Craftsman Truck Series ride. Tammy is very talented and a great person as well. She got a bad break because while the sponsorship money was there, it was evidently not used to give Tammy the truck that she needed to compete with the top teams.. Nonetheless, on the race track, she proved her point and I ume went back home to Georgia to run her motorcycle shop. Tammy Jo definitely didn't get the recognition she deserved.
